c語言中如何求字符串長度 language對應(yīng)的字符串長度?
language對應(yīng)的字符串長度?在二進制碼與其它雙字節(jié)字符系統(tǒng)混用時,字節(jié)數(shù)二進制碼字符個數(shù)雙字節(jié)字符個數(shù)*2,而當年字符串長度到底怎么統(tǒng)計就不好說了,有的語言如c ,那時候字符串長度字節(jié)數(shù),有的
language對應(yīng)的字符串長度?
在二進制碼與其它雙字節(jié)字符系統(tǒng)混用時,字節(jié)數(shù)二進制碼字符個數(shù)雙字節(jié)字符個數(shù)*2,而當年字符串長度到底怎么統(tǒng)計就不好說了,有的語言如c ,那時候字符串長度字節(jié)數(shù),有的語言如sql,當年字符產(chǎn)長度字符個數(shù)。
C語言char** 字符串數(shù)組長度如何獲???
這個樣子翻譯出來的話,我個人估計,你是想寫在函數(shù)里面作為參數(shù)吧,如果是這樣的話,建議多加一個參數(shù)unsignedintlen,用len把相應(yīng)的長度傳進來,畢竟給它分配空間的人肯定是知道長度的。就想一般的intmain(intargc,char**argv)一樣,argc就是參數(shù)個數(shù)
c語言中for語句計算字符串長度?
ruby的字符串是由字符數(shù)組形式保存的,并約定#390#39(base64碼值為0)作為字符串結(jié)束符。其長度為從字符串開始,到#390#39結(jié)束,所有字符的個數(shù),不包括#390#39本身。
要獲得字符串長度,有兩種方法可以使用,使用庫函數(shù)strlen()。
strlen聲明在string.h中,原型為intstrlen(char*str);功能為求str的長度,并返回。對于字符串str,可以用代碼求長度。當str[len]為中午12時,退出循環(huán),退出后的len值就是str的長度。拓展資料:使用strlen函數(shù),包含在頭文件string.h里,功能就是計算字符串s的(unsignedint型)不包括#390#39在內(nèi)的長度。
c語言 最長的無重復(fù)字符串長度為7?
#includestdio.h
intfun(charstr[7]);
intmain()
{
charstr[7]{
};
inti0;
echo(輸入7個字符的字符串:
);
scanf(%s,str);
fun(str);
for(i0;i5-11300h;i){
sort(%c,str);
}
}
intfun(charstr[7])
{
inti0,temp0;
intj0;
for(i1,j5;ij;i,j--){
if(strstr[j]){
tempstr;
strstr[j];
str[j]temp;
}
}
return;
}